This project explores the multifaceted role of event posters in professional practice, where they must capture attention, convey key details, and set the tone for an event. The task is to design three posters featuring Ruby J. Thelot at Multiple Formats, focusing on how typography and layout can balance creativity with clarity. Each poster will establish a clear visual hierarchy, guiding viewers seamlessly through the speaker’s profile and event details.



Final Three Posters: 

#1:
Black and white only.
Use only 2 point sizes on the poster.
Rely solely on type and layout to achieve visual impact. 



#2:
2 colors typographic poster.
Point sizes to use: 8pt / 13pt / 21pt / 34pt / 55pt / 89pt / 144pt / 233pt



#3:
No constrains on colors.
Use no more than 3 point sizes on the poster.
Experiment with large type sizes, heavy weights, and dynamic layouts.
